The 10-Minute Rule for Simply Solar Illinois
Indicators on Simply Solar Illinois You Need To KnowTable of ContentsThe Greatest Guide To Simply Solar IllinoisThe Ultimate Guide To Simply Solar IllinoisSome Known Questions About Simply Solar Illinois.Simply Solar Illinois Things To Know Before You BuyHow Simply Solar Illinois can Save You Time, Stress, and Money.Along with these industries, Ado